3 Die in Goregaon House Fire, Electrical Fault Suspected

A horrific fire in a residential building in Mumbai's western suburbs claimed the lives of three members of a family in the early hours of Saturday. The incident has sent shockwaves through the Bhagatsingh Nagar locality in Goregaon (West).

Tragic Loss in the Dead of Night

The Mumbai Fire Brigade (MFB) received an urgent call at around 3:06 am reporting a blaze in a ground-plus-one-storey structure. By the time help arrived, the fire had already engulfed parts of the home, spreading rapidly through electric wiring and household articles on the ground floor. Flames also raced through clothing stored on the first floor, creating a deadly trap for the occupants inside.

Alert neighbours, awakened by the commotion, rushed to the scene in a desperate bid to help. They attempted to fight the flames using buckets of water before the professional firefighting teams could reach the spot. Their courageous efforts, however, could not prevent the tragedy that unfolded within the burning house.

Rescue Efforts and Fatal Outcome

Fire personnel, upon arrival, worked swiftly to cut off the electric supply to prevent the fire from worsening. They then managed to completely extinguish the blaze by 3:16 am. During the operation, they rescued three individuals who were trapped inside the burning home.

The victims were immediately rushed for medical aid. They were transported using a police van and a private vehicle to the nearby Trauma Care Hospital in Goregaon. Despite the rapid response, doctors at the hospital could not save them. All three were declared dead upon arrival. They had sustained severe burn injuries.

The deceased have been identified as Harshada Pawaskar (19), Kushal Pawaskar (12), and Sanjog Pawaskar (48). The loss of two young lives, including that of a child, has added to the profound grief of the community.

Investigation into the Cause

While the exact cause of the fire is still under investigation, preliminary details strongly point towards a fault in the electrical wiring as the origin of the disaster. Officials have confirmed that a detailed probe is currently underway to ascertain the precise sequence of events that led to this fatal incident.
